/** * Show all industries with the new one on top * * @return Response */ public function index() { //$industries = Industry::latest()->get(); $industries = Industry::all(); return view('industries.index', compact('industries')); //return response()->json($industries); }
/** * List all industries * @return Response */ public function index() { try { if (!($user = JWTAuth::parseToken()->authenticate())) { return response()->json(['user_not_found'], 404); } } catch (Tymon\JWTAuth\Exceptions\TokenExpiredException $e) { return response()->json(['token_expired'], $e->getStatusCode()); } catch (Tymon\JWTAuth\Exceptions\TokenInvalidException $e) { return response()->json(['token_invalid'], $e->getStatusCode()); } catch (Tymon\JWTAuth\Exceptions\JWTException $e) { return response()->json(['token_absent'], $e->getStatusCode()); } // the token is valid and we have found the user via the sub claim //$industry = Industry::latest()->get(); $industries = Industry::all(); return response()->json(compact('industries')); }
/** * Show the form for creating a new resource. * * @return Response */ public function create() { if (Auth::user()->identifier == 3) { $title = 'dataUpdate'; $roles = Role::lists('name', 'id'); $rolesShow = Role::all(); $functionalAreas = FunctionalAreas::lists('name', 'id'); $faShow = FunctionalAreas::all(); $industry = Industry::lists('name', 'id'); $industryShow = Industry::all(); $skills = Skills::lists('name', 'id'); $indfunctionalMapping = Industry_functional_area_mappings::leftJoin('industries', 'industry_functional_area_mappings.industry', '=', 'industries.id')->leftJoin('functional_areas', 'industry_functional_area_mappings.functional_area', '=', 'functional_areas.id')->get([DB::raw('concat(industries.name, " - ", functional_areas.name) as name'), 'industry_functional_area_mappings.id as id'])->lists('name', 'id'); $industryfareaShow = Industry_functional_area_mappings::leftJoin('industries', 'industry_functional_area_mappings.industry', '=', 'industries.id')->leftJoin('functional_areas', 'industry_functional_area_mappings.functional_area', '=', 'functional_areas.id')->get(['industries.name as name', 'functional_areas.name as fareaname', 'industry_functional_area_mappings.id']); // $indfunctional = Industry_functional_area_mappings::leftJoin('industries', 'industry_functional_area_mappings.industry', '=', 'industries.id') // ->leftJoin('functional_areas', 'industry_functional_area_mappings.functional_area', '=', 'functional_areas.id') // ->get([DB::raw('concat(industries.name, " - ", functional_areas.name) as name'), 'industry_functional_area_mappings.id as id']); // $industryfarearoleShow = Industry_functional_area_role_mapping::leftJoin('roles', 'industry_functional_area_role_mapping.role', '=', 'roles.id') // ->get(['roles.name as name', $indfunctional]); return view('pages.adminUpdate', compact('title', 'skills', 'roles', 'functionalAreas', 'industry', 'indfunctionalMapping', 'rolesShow', 'faShow', 'industryShow', 'industryfareaShow', 'industryfarearoleShow')); // return $indfunctionalMapping; } else { return redirect('/home'); } }
/** * Display a listing of the resource. * * @return Response */ public function index() { // $industries = Industry::all(); return view('industries.index', compact('industries')); }